What does a roll up garage door entail?

A roll up garage door consists of horizontal slats that coil up into a drum above the opening as it opens. This design is known for its durability and space-saving features, making it a practical choice for many Atlanta homes and businesses. What is a chain drive garage door opener?

A chain drive garage door opener uses a chain to move the trolley, which opens and closes your garage door. The chain runs along a rail above the door. This type of opener is generally reliable and cost-effective. While it can be a bit noisier than other types, it's a popular choice for many homeowners in Atlanta. What is a wall mount garage door opener?

A wall mount garage door opener, also known as a jackshaft opener, mounts directly to the torsion spring shaft on the wall next to the garage door. This design saves valuable ceiling space, which is great for storage or accommodating taller vehicles in your Atlanta garage. It also typically offers quieter operation.
